Market Research
Conducting thorough market research is the first step in launching any startup. Understanding your target audience, competitors, and industry trends is crucial. Gather information using tools like surveys, focus groups, and data analytics. Identify market gaps and consumer needs that your product or service can address. Analyzing competitors’ strengths and weaknesses can also help you find opportunities for differentiation.
Business Plan Creation
A well-crafted business plan outlines your startup’s mission, vision, and strategy. It should include:
- Executive Summary: A brief overview of your business idea and objectives.
- Market Analysis: Your market research insights include the target audience and competitive landscape.
- Organization Structure: Details about your team and their roles.
- Product or Service Line: Describe your offering and how it meets market needs.
- Marketing and Sales Strategy: Plans for attracting and retaining customers.
- Financial Projections: Revenue models, funding requirements, and financial forecasts.
A comprehensive business plan guides your startup’s growth and attracts potential investors.
Legal Considerations
Navigating the legal landscape is a critical step. Ensure your business complies with local, state, and federal regulations. This includes registering your business, obtaining necessary licenses and permits, and understanding tax obligations. Protecting your intellectual property through trademarks, patents, or copyrights can safeguard your unique ideas and products. Consulting with a legal professional can help you avoid pitfalls and ensure your startup operates within the law.
Initial Funding Strategies
Securing initial funding is often one of the biggest challenges for startups. Various funding options are available:
- Bootstrapping: Using personal savings or revenue from early sales to fund the business.
- Angel Investors: High-net-worth individuals who provide capital in exchange for equity.
- Venture Capital: Investment firms that offer funding in exchange for equity, typically for high-growth startups.
- Crowdfunding: Raising small amounts of money from many people, usually through online platforms.

Emerging Trends and Technologies
Staying ahead of the curve in 2024 involves leveraging emerging trends and technologies. Here are a few to consider:
-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I can enhance customer experiences, automate tasks, and provide valuable insights through data analysis.
- Blockchain: Beyond cryptocurrencies, blockchain technology offers transaction security and transparency and can be applied in various industries.
- Remote Work Solutions: With the rise of remote work, tools that facilitate virtual collaboration and communication are more important than ever.
- Sustainability: Consumers are increasingly prioritizing sustainability. Incorporating eco-friendly practices can attract environmentally conscious customers.
Adopting these trends can give your startup a competitive edge and resonate with modern consumers.
